1. HOME
  2. ブログ
  3. アプリ・システム開発の基礎知識
  4. “ゼロダウンタイム移行”の基礎知識と実践 ─ 業務を止めないシステム移行の新常識
BLOG

ブログ

アプリ・システム開発の基礎知識

“ゼロダウンタイム移行”の基礎知識と実践 ─ 業務を止めないシステム移行の新常識

業務システム開発やWebシステム開発、アプリ開発会社にシステム開発を依頼する際、「リニューアル」や「基幹システムの入れ替え」は避けて通れないテーマです。しかし、システム移行=「業務停止が発生する」「夜間・休日対応が必要」「最悪トラブルで復旧に長時間」──そんな“常識”に頭を悩ませる現場は後を絶ちません。

そこで今、国内外の先進企業が新基準として導入を進めるのが「ゼロダウンタイム移行」です。本記事では、ゼロダウンタイム移行の基礎知識と実践ノウハウを、見積もり依頼・費用対効果・コスト削減など現場視点で徹底解説します。

なぜ今“ゼロダウンタイム移行”が求められるのか

  • 業務システムの“24時間365日運用”が当たり前に

  • 物流・EC・金融・医療など「止められない」業種のシステム依存度が急増

  • 「土日や夜間の特別対応」によるコスト・現場負荷が限界に

  • ダウンタイムによる損失コスト(売上・信用・労務コスト)が年々拡大

  • 開発会社やWeb開発会社選定時に「ゼロダウンタイム移行対応」が重要視されている

ゼロダウンタイム移行とは?その原理とアプローチ

「ゼロダウンタイム移行」とは、
「既存システムを稼働させながら新システムへ段階的に切り替え、利用者や現場に“停止時間ゼロ”でサービス移行を実現する」技術と運用の総称です。

  • リアルタイム複製:新旧システム両方に同時データ反映(Dual-write、CDCなど)

  • 段階的切り替え(カナリアリリース/ブルーグリーンデプロイメント):一部ユーザー・拠点ごとに新システムへ移行

  • リハーサル・リカバリ設計:失敗時も即時切り戻し可能な運用設計

  • 運用現場との二重体制期間:切替期は新旧同時サポートでトラブルリスクを最小化

ゼロダウンタイム移行の具体的な技術パターン

1. データベース移行のリアルタイム同期

  • Change Data Capture(CDC)による差分データ複製

  • 双方向レプリケーションで、旧DB・新DBどちらにも変更反映

  • 同期検証・差分チェックツールによるデータ整合性の維持

2. アプリケーション/APIの段階的切り替え

  • 新旧APIエンドポイントをパラレル運用、アクセス先を徐々に新システムへ振り分け

  • 機能単位・サービス単位での「部分移行」も可能

  • フロントエンド・バックエンド双方のバージョン管理が要

3. インフラ・クラウド基盤のブルーグリーンデプロイメント

  • 新旧インフラを平行構築し、DNSやロードバランサで段階的にトラフィックを切替

  • 障害時も即時旧環境へ戻せる構成を準備

  • クラウド(AWS、Azure、GCP等)環境で特に主流

4. システム運用体制・サポートの“二重化”

  • 切り替え期間は新旧運用フローを並行稼働

  • 問い合わせ・障害発生時のサポート責任分担を明確化

  • 切り替え進捗の可視化・現場負担軽減のための管理ツール活用

導入ユースケース:ゼロダウンタイム移行が業務現場を救った事例

ケース1:ECサイト基幹システム刷新

  • 200万件以上の商品データ・顧客データをリアルタイム同期

  • 会員・受注・在庫機能ごとに段階移行、売上“ゼロダウン”でリリース完了

  • システム開発会社の高度な移行スクリプトと現場連携がカギ

ケース2:物流システムのクラウド移行

  • 配送管理・倉庫管理の両システムを段階的に新クラウド基盤へ

  • 夜間・休日も業務継続、移行中のエラーも即時検知&切り戻し

  • 保守運用体制を移行前から並行構築、トラブルゼロ

ケース3:医療機関向け業務システムのリプレイス

  • 患者情報・レセプト・予約データを新旧でリアルタイム同期

  • 移行中も診療・受付は完全通常稼働

  • 運用担当者との“二重体制”で現場混乱なし

ゼロダウンタイム移行のための要件定義・プロジェクト管理

  • 移行対象システムの全機能・データ項目・連携先を網羅的に洗い出し

  • 「どこまでを“止めずに”移行するか」現場との合意形成

  • リハーサル・テスト工程を複数回実施、シナリオごとの“想定外”検証

  • 進捗管理・責任分担を明確にしたタスク管理とコミュニケーション体制

開発会社選定・見積もり依頼時のチェックポイント

  • 過去のゼロダウンタイム移行実績・ノウハウの有無

  • 導入前後の運用サポート体制・教育プラン

  • 移行設計・リハーサル工数・万一時の切戻し対応費用の透明性

  • 現場負担・業務リスクを最小化する提案力

費用対効果・コスト削減のシミュレーション

  • 移行ダウンタイムをゼロにすることで「機会損失」「残業・休日出勤コスト」を大幅削減

  • 業務停止に伴うリスク(売上損失・顧客離脱・現場ストレス)を回避

  • 移行プロジェクト後の保守運用費用も“現場最適化”で中長期的に圧縮

  • システム開発会社やWeb開発会社の選定時に「費用対効果」を定量比較

よくある課題と成功へのヒント

  • 「現場の理解不足」「移行後のサポート体制不足」が失敗の要因

  • テストデータ・移行リハーサルを徹底することで“想定外”を潰す

  • 段階移行・二重運用期間を適切に設けることで心理的ハードルを下げる

  • エンドユーザー・現場担当者も含めた“全員参加”の移行体験

今後の展望:ゼロダウンタイム移行がもたらす業務システムの未来

  • サービス停止ゼロのリニューアルが「新常識」に

  • クラウドネイティブ/マイクロサービス連携でさらなる柔軟性

  • DX推進・業務デジタル化の中核技術に

  • 「止めない」「現場負担ゼロ」を実現する次世代開発会社・アプリ開発会社が選ばれる時代へ

まとめ:業務を止めない移行が企業価値を最大化する

ゼロダウンタイム移行は、単なる“技術選定”ではなく、
開発会社選定・見積もり比較・費用対効果最大化のカギとなる新常識です。

今後のシステム開発依頼やリニューアルプロジェクトでは、「止めない移行」のノウハウと実績を持つ開発パートナーを積極的に評価しましょう。

お問合せ

不明点やお見積りの依頼などお気軽にください。




問い合わせを行う

関連記事